About the role

Provide mental health assessments, crisis intervention, and referrals for patients in the Emergency Department. Coordinate discharge planning and act as a liaison between mental health services and community agencies.

Position Summary

Responsible for providing mental health services to patients presenting in the Emergency Department, including crisis/intake assessment and intervention, making appropriate referral for acuity, providing education, discharge planning, acting as a community liaison, offering assistance to family members. Education, License & Cert: A Bachelors’ Degree in Psychology, or Human Services related field is required.

Experience

  • One year’s experience working in a psychiatric setting, a human service field or a related field.
  • Essential
  • Functions: 1. Provides evaluations, assessments, crisis intervention and referral for all populations served by the department in the emergency room. 2. Demonstrates the ability to document understandable, comprehensible psychiatric evaluation and progress notes. 3. Responsible discharge planning and arranges follow‐up care and referrals. 4. Functions as a liaison between the Mental Health services and community agencies and maintains knowledge if the community resources that may be used in treatment planning. 5. Recognizes and identifies actual or potential situations which places the organization at risk for corporate compliance violations. Communicates compliance issues/concerns with department manager and/or follows the policy for addressing the situation.
  • Other
  • Duties: 1. Complies with Department and organizational policies and procedures. 2. Performs other duties as assigned. The pay for this position ranges from $19.87-$31.48 per hour #LI-BB1

  • The Guthrie Clinic is a non-profit, integrated, practicing physician-led organization in the Twin Tiers of New York and Pennsylvania.
  • Our multi-specialty group practice of more than 500 physicians and 302 advanced practice providers offers 47 specialties through a regional office network providing primary and specialty care in 22 communities.
  • Guthrie Medical Education Programs include General Surgery, Internal Medicine, Emergency Medicine, Family Medicine, Anesthesiology and Orthopedic Surgery Residency, as well as Cardiovascular, Gastroenterology and Pulmonary Critical Care Fellowship programs.
  • Guthrie is also a clinical campus for the Geisinger Commonwealth School of Medicine.
